I'm thinking of rewiring my HSH Ibanez a bit to make it even more versatile.  It has 1 volume, 1 tone and a 5 way blade, the humbuckers are hot but I'm gonna change out the single soon as it sucks.

I'm thinking to put a push pull volume pot in that coil splits both humbuckers in all 5 positions.
I was also originally thinking that I would have a tone push pull to add the neck pickup (wether HB or SC, depending on volume pushpull state) to positions 1 and 2.

Are there any wiring diagrams that anyone has to do this kind of setup as I can't find any or is it too complex and stupid, etc etc... Let me know what you think.

My current switch setup:
5- Neck HB
4- Neck HB (split inner coil) + Middle SC
3- Middle SC
2- Bridge HB (split inner coil) + Middle SC
1- Bridge HB

    Difficult to recommend a suitable replacement S sized middle pickup without knowing exactly how powerful the humbuckers are. 

    Difficult to recommend a specific replacement selector switch without knowing how much space is available in the guitar to accommodate it. OTAX and Schaller both offer 24-contact Superswitches on a single thickness PCB.

    Finally, do you need the replacement middle pickup to be noise-cancelling in its own right?
